V-Ray is widely regarded as the premier rendering solution for SketchUp, capable of transforming basic 3D models into stunning, lifelike images. However, its extensive array of settings can be daunting for beginners and even experienced users. The key to efficiency is understanding that there is no single "magic" setup; the optimal settings vary for every project.
